Qiu Min is a complicated character. Definitely not a good person but it's complicated. She appears weak but even when she was a pathetic little girl, she always knew how to get to Qiu Yan. She was the one who convinced Qiu Yan to give herself over to the He family, essentially sealing her fate. She made it sound like it would be the right thing for Qiu Yan to do but really, she only said it because it served her. She looked down on Qiu Yan for going after Qin Xuan and calling her behavior indecent but really, she said that because she wanted her own chance with Qin Xuan. Even later when she convinced QY to break up with QX, she made it sound like she was implicating him but really, she just didn't like the idea of QY escaping with her lover. Over and over again, she uses etiquette and rules, and decency to shame Qiu Yan but all of her words are self-serving. Although she has experienced terrible things, I still think her main motivation is to get revenge against Qiu Yan. She judged the way QY pursued QX but the way she herself got with Qin Xuan was the most morally corrupted and indecent way possible. So she only remembers the rules of conduct when they serve her agenda against Qiu Yan and not all the time.
